How do i re-set fuser unit replacement message on bizhub c253

SIR/MAM
TROUBLE RESET

FIRST, If this code comes back. Have a technician look at it DO NOT CONTINUE TO RESET the code!!!! AS this is for the Hot Part called the FUSER. It can catch on fire! And that will ruin a perfectly good day!!!!
1. Turn OFF the main power switch.
2. Turn main power switch ON while pressing the Utility/Counter key.
3. Touch [Trouble Reset].
4. Check to make sure that [OK] is displayed and the it has been reset.
5. After turning off the main power switch, turn it on again more than 10 seconds after and check if the machine starts correctly.

Konica minolta bizhub C253 is showing me trouble code C- 2556. What should I do to pix this problem

Konica-Minolta bizhub C253 Trouble Error Codes List page 4

Code C2556
Abnormally high toner density detected yellow TCR sensor
• TC ratio in the developing machine, which is determined by toner replenishing amount control mechanism, is 11 % or more for a given number of times consecutively. • When the connector of the TCR sensor is disconnected.
Solution:
1 Reinstall imaging unit. 2 Reinstall toner cartridge. 3 M3, M4 operation check (At this time, IU must be non-installation.). 4 Change imaging unit. 5 Change PRCB

What s error code c-2554 of konica minolta bizhub c253?

C 2554 Abnormally high toner density detected Magenta TCR sensor.
Clean the TCR sensor window on the underside of the imaging unit if dirty,reinstall imaging unit or change imaging unit.
